Key Features to Consider
When picking a Small Wine Fridge (see here now), think about the following features:
Capacity: Depending on your collection, you'll want to choose a fridge that can accommodate your requirements. Small designs generally range from 8 to 30 bottles.
Temperature Zones: Some small wine fridges feature double temperature level zones, permitting you to keep red and gewurztraminers at their ideal temperature levels.
Cooling System: Compressors normally offer remarkable temperature control, however thermoelectric models are quieter and more energy-efficient.
Material and Build: Look for designs with UV-protected glass doors to avoid light damage and wood shelves for much better stability and visual appeal.
Mobility: Consider how quickly you can move it if needed. Some designs feature wheels or lighter styles.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Do small wine fridges require a venting area?
A1: Yes, while many small wine fridges are developed for very little ventilation, it's still recommended to permit some area for airflow around the system.
Q2: Can I store champagne in a small wine fridge?
A2: While a lot of small wine fridges are implied for still red wines, some designs can accommodate champagne. Examine the specifications to guarantee it supplies the right temperature.
Q3: How do I maintain my small wine fridge?
A3: Regularly tidy the interior, check the temperature level settings, and ensure the seals on the doors are tight to preserve ideal conditions.
Q4: Can I store opened bottles in a wine fridge?
A4: Yes, storing opened bottles in a wine fridge is suggested, as it assists decrease oxidation.
Q5: What's the ideal temperature for red and white wines?
A5: Red red wines are preferably saved at around 55 ° F to 65 ° F, while gewurztraminers fare better when kept between 45 ° F to 55 ° F.
